2012년 10월 4일 목요일
2012년 9월 28일 금요일
[Jsp][자바스크립트] 쿠키 생성, 얻기
언젠가 어디선가 보고 사용하는 소스인데 출처는 까묵었다 ;;;;
function setCookie(name,value){
var argc = setCookie.arguments.length;
var argv = setCookie.arguments;
var expires = ( argc > 2) ? argv[2]:null;
var path = ( argc > 3) ? argv[3]:null;
var domain = ( argc > 4) ? argv[4]:null;
var secure = ( argc > 5) ? argv[5]:false;
document.cookie = name + "=" + escape(value) +
((expires == null) ? "" : ("; expires =" + expires.toGMTString())) +
((path == null) ? "" : ("; path =" + path)) +
((domain == null) ? "" : ("; domain =" + domain)) +
((domain == true) ? "; secure" : "");
}
function getCookie (name) {
var dcookie = document.cookie;
var cname = name + "=";
var clen = dcookie.length;
var cbegin = 0;
while (cbegin < clen) {
var vbegin = cbegin + cname.length;
if (dcookie.substring(cbegin, vbegin) == cname) {
var vend = dcookie.indexOf (";", vbegin);
if (vend == -1) vend = clen;
return unescape(dcookie.substring(vbegin, vend));
}
cbegin = dcookie.indexOf(" ", cbegin) + 1;
if (cbegin == 0) break;
}
return "";
}
2012년 3월 16일 금요일
2012년 2월 27일 월요일
2012년 1월 20일 금요일
[Jsp][자바스크립트] NaN 체크
문자열을 숫자로 변환하려고 할때,
잘못된 값이면 NaN을 반환한다.
반환된 값이 NaN인가를 체크하기 위해서는
isNaN 함수를 사용
var test1 = parseFloat(document.getElementById(param_min).value);
if(isNaN(test1)){
document.getElementById(param_min).focus();
return false;
}
잘못된 값이면 NaN을 반환한다.
반환된 값이 NaN인가를 체크하기 위해서는
isNaN 함수를 사용
var test1 = parseFloat(document.getElementById(param_min).value);
if(isNaN(test1)){
document.getElementById(param_min).focus();
return false;
}
2012년 1월 4일 수요일
[Jsp] Get 방식 파라미터 한글깨짐
Get방식으로 보내는데 한글깨짐 현상이 발생하여, 밑에방식으로 인코딩해서 보내봤더니 된다.
String lotNo = lotPlus(request);
String lotNo_En = java.net.URLEncoder.encode(lotNo, "UTF-8");
String URL = "test-run?LOT_NO=" + lotNo_En;
response.sendRedirect(URL);
String lotNo_En = java.net.URLEncoder.encode(lotNo, "UTF-8");
String URL = "test-run?LOT_NO=" + lotNo_En;
response.sendRedirect(URL);
아님 이거
encodeURIComponent(testname)
피드 구독하기:
글 (Atom)